How to Avoid Common Pitfalls When Ordering canvas discount prints
First rule: **upload high-res images only**. If your file’s under 2MB or looks grainy on your phone, it’ll look worse blown up. CanvasDiscount recommends at least 150 DPI at print size—use their built-in resolution checker to be safe. Second, don’t skip the preview tool. Their AR feature lets you see how the print looks in your actual room (game-changer for avoiding “too big for the space” regrets). Third, always check the promo fine print—some canvas discount prints codes exclude certain finishes or sizes. And finally? Order a sample pack if you’re unsure. For $5, they’ll mail you swatches of all finishes so you can feel the difference before you commit.
